Kenny Andrew Posted October 8, 2018 Share Posted October 8, 2018 The market has been flooded recently with these type of enamel signs, any originals I have seen tend to have a double border, although not in all cases, you have to be very careful with these. They did exist but allot are now coming out of Eastern Europe. Here is an original with the double border. Originals usually have a maker mark to the reverse, as far as I know Auer of Berlin were best known for making gasmasks. It is possible they made signs as well but these are the first I have seen by this maker. 2 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
